    About Euclid Subacute Care Center

    Euclid Subacute Care Center sits in Euclid, Ohio, right at 18901 Lake Shore Blvd, and is surrounded by 17 acres along the shore of Lake Erie, so there's room to walk outside or enjoy the garden area if folks want some fresh air or just some quiet time. The place runs as a non-profit and is tied to Cleveland Clinic, being actually within Euclid Hospital, and people will probably notice that connection in the range of healthcare services, since they offer things like emergency care all day and night, subacute care after a hospital stay, and a full spectrum of therapies and support for those recovering from illness, injury, or surgery. Residents get help with daily needs, things like bathing, dressing, medication, and getting in or out of bed or a chair, plus there's a non-ambulatory care program for those who have trouble moving around on their own, and a staff always ready with a 24-hour emergency alert system to keep people safe. There are private, furnished rooms for comfort as well as common spaces including a community dining area, an arts room, walking paths, and even a barber or salon. Special diets are handled by the dining staff, so if someone has a food allergy or needs a certain meal, they do their best to work with that, and the laundry services are part of what folks can count on, no fuss needed. The center has both resident-run and community-run programs, so along with movie nights, people living there can join in activities or even help organize events, and there's always something on the calendar to keep up a sense of connection and purpose. Residents who need skilled nursing care will find certified beds with a forecast for new openings in June 2025, and since the center takes both Medicare and Medicaid, people with those forms of coverage can get help paying for their care here. The place has regular imaging and lab services, as well as specialized hours for mammography, which people can use if that's needed, and appointments are usually the way to go for those. Everything-from support with basic daily living to subacute therapy-is covered by a team that stays on-site all day, which helps if someone is worried about unexpected health issues. The Euclid Subacute Care Center isn't fancy, but there's a long history here of serving the community, looking after people who need skilled nursing, recovery support, or just a safe place to stay when more care's required, and with the connection to Cleveland Clinic, it's able to keep up with some of the advanced medical technology and treatments that modern healthcare needs.
